In the context of the coronavirus epidemic afflicting China, Magali Fakhry Dufresne, exhibition director, Palexpo, announced that INDEX and Palexpo SA are carefully observing the situation and its possible implications for its employees, exhibitors and visitors.
Palexpo is in regular contact with the General Directorate of Health of the Republic and Canton of Geneva and its medical advisor to develop a sanitary action plan adjustable in real time. This plan recommends the implementation of a program of cleaning, disinfection and prevention across public highpoints such as catering areas, WCs, handrails, public touch-screens along with the use of correct cleaning/sanitizing materials and products. This awareness campaign will be aimed at staff, exhibitors and visitors. In this process, Palexpo is following the recommendations of the competent public health authorities in the field, namely the Federal Office of Public Health (FOPH).
Palexpo confirms that INDEX20 will proceed as planned and that so far, there have been no registration impact on the event.
"We also strongly recommend that you keep yourself up to date with the information from these authorities, so that you can react as best as possible to potential questions from your employees and partners," Fakhry Dufresne says.
